Plumbing costs change based on the complexity of the repair and the accessibility of the pipes. If a pro needs to cut into drywall or dig underground to reach a leak, the labor time increases. Older homes sometimes require updating outdated materials, like galvanized steel, to meet current codes. The timing of the service also matters, as after-hours or holiday calls often carry different rates than standard business hours. While simple drain clearings or fixture swaps are usually on the lower end, larger system repipes cost more.

Installing a water softener in Colorado Springs involves connecting it to your main water line. A plumber will shut off the water and drain the existing pipes. They then install the softener's intake and output lines. Finally, they connect it to your home's plumbing system and test for leaks. Call us for a free quote on this service.
If your toilet in Colorado Springs is leaking, check the tank first. Look for worn-out flappers or seals. A constant trickle into the bowl often means a bad flapper. If it's leaking around the base, the wax ring might be the issue. You can often temporarily stop it by turning off the water valve behind the toilet. We can send a pro for a free estimate.

Clogged sinks in Colorado Springs are usually caused by hair, soap scum, grease, or food debris. Over time, these build up in the pipes. Using too much drain cleaner can also damage pipes. Sometimes, a clog is deeper in the main sewer line. A plumber can quickly diagnose and clear the blockage. Get a free quote by calling us.
